Phase 10: deployment (Apache compose + proxy fragments, CI release) + docs
- deploy/docker-compose.yml: pinned-tag ghcr image, hardened (cap_drop ALL + minimal cap_add, no-new-privileges, panel bound to 127.0.0.1 only). Apache itself runs on the host (spec 10.5), fragment at deploy/apache/. - Alternative reverse-proxy fragments: nginx (+certbot sidecar), Caddy (automatic ACME), Traefik (+acme.json PEM extraction script). - .github/workflows/release.yml: tag-triggered ghcr.io publish, version piped from the git tag into both the binary ldflags and the image tag (spec 10.1). - Closed a gap from Phase 1: logrotate was installed but never invoked; wired up build/logrotate-mail.conf + logrotate-loop.sh + a supervisor program (copytruncate, since postlogd holds mail.log open with nothing to signal on rotation). - README rewritten: site requirements checklist, reverse-proxy comparison, DNS setup (server- vs domain-level), IP warmup, backup/restore vs domain export/import, fixed-tag rationale, machine requirements.
